Vestibular Rehabilitation: Finding Equilibrium & Relief Are you're experiencing dizziness or perceive unsteady? Inner ear rehabilitation, often called vestibular therapy, can be a targeted program intended to manage disorders affecting the vestibular system. This system, essential for preserving equilibrium and spatial , can be disrupted due to conditions like Meniere’s disease , head injuries, or degenerative changes. Vestibular rehabilitation includes a series of therapies to retrain the nervous system to adjust for vestibular dysfunction. Usual treatment may include: Specific head maneuvers Gaze stabilization exercises Reduction exercises to alleviate unsteadiness Information on dealing with ailments Speak with a medical professional to see if if vestibular rehabilitation is right for you're .
